随着移动应用的普及,越来越多的企业和开发者开始关注如何为用户提供稳定、快速的应用体验。服务器配置的选择是影响用户体验的关键因素之一。本文将探讨在100人使用APP的情况下,如何选择合适的服务器配置。
了解用户需求与应用场景
选择合适的服务器配置需要从用户需求和应用场景出发。对于100人的用户群体,我们需要考虑以下几点:
– 用户分布:用户的地理位置是否集中在某一地区?如果用户分布在不同国家或地区,可能需要考虑多区域部署或多云架构,以减少延迟。
– 应用类型:是社交类、游戏类还是工具类应用?不同类型的应用对服务器资源的需求差异较大。例如,社交类应用可能更注重并发处理能力,而工具类应用则可能更依赖于计算性能。
– 数据量与存储需求:应用是否会频繁读写大量数据?如果应用涉及到大量的图片、视频等多媒体内容,那么存储空间和带宽将是关键考虑因素。
评估服务器性能指标
在确定了用户需求和应用场景后,接下来需要评估服务器的核心性能指标,以确保能够满足100名用户的正常使用。
– CPU与内存:对于100人规模的应用,通常建议选择4核8GB以上的配置。如果是高并发场景(如聊天、直播等),则需要更高的CPU核心数和更大的内存容量来保证系统的响应速度。
– 网络带宽:带宽决定了数据传输的速度和稳定性。根据应用类型的不同,建议选择50Mbps以上的带宽。如果是视频流媒体类应用,则需要更高的带宽支持。
– 存储空间:除了系统盘外,还需要额外预留足够的存储空间用于保存用户生成的内容。对于中小型应用,100GB左右的SSD硬盘通常足够应对初期的需求。
选择云服务提供商
为了更好地管理服务器资源并降低运维成本,许多企业和开发者会选择云服务平台来托管其应用程序。目前市面上有许多知名的云服务商,如阿里云、腾讯云、AWS等。它们提供了丰富的服务器实例规格供用户选择。
在选择云服务提供商时,可以参考以下几个方面:
– 价格与性价比:不同云厂商提供的相同配置下价格可能存在差异。可以通过对比各平台的价格策略以及优惠活动,选择最具性价比的服务。
– 技术支持与文档完善程度:良好的售后服务和技术支持可以帮助企业在遇到问题时及时得到帮助。详细的官方文档也能让开发人员更快地上手操作。
– 地域覆盖范围:如果你的应用面向全球市场,则需要选择那些在全球范围内拥有广泛数据中心布局的云服务商,以便实现跨区域的数据同步和服务调用。
在为100人规模的应用选择合适的服务器配置时,需要综合考虑用户需求、应用场景、性能指标以及云服务提供商等多个方面。通过合理规划资源配置,不仅可以提升用户体验,还能有效控制运营成本。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/88975.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。